Ticket: Expired creds blocking fan-out backpressure tests

Hey — the Quailbarrow notification fan-out keeps tripping its backpressure limiter in staging, but our test harness can't even connect because the old service credentials expired last Friday. Ops minted a fresh one this morning. Swap it into your local config and rerun the load scenario; the new key is below.

gateway credential: zpat4_626B

Hey — handing off Switchgrove, our feature-flag rollout framework, while I'm out next week. Everything's stable, but two flags are mid-ramp: the checkout redesign (at 25%) and the new search ranker (at 5%). If error rates spike, just freeze the ramp; don't roll back unless Dario from platform agrees. The kill switch works instantly, no deploy needed. All ramp schedules, owner contacts, and the freeze procedure are written up on the internal page below.

runbook for kahap-tajef: https://grafana.norvalabs.corp/display/display/job/9361511189b8

Ticket: Drift in Bookhaven catalogue importer

Importer config on prod no longer matches the repo. Someone hand-edited batch sizes during the Fernدale backlog — reverted partially, not tracked. Nightly MARC imports now dedupe inconsistently across the two workers. Don't patch the boxes directly; fix the source and redeploy. Until then, treat the repo as stale. Current live values on worker-a are as follows.

config for kafof-bawef:
holath:
  log_level: debug
  metrics_host: metrics.holath.qorvelsys.internal
  pin: 2191
  pool_size: 32

## Ownership: Date Localization

All date-format localization in Calverly lives under `src/locale/dates`. Changes here must preserve existing locale snapshots, handle non-Gregorian calendars gracefully, and avoid hardcoded separators. Reviewers should request an updated snapshot diff for every affected locale. Final review authority for this module belongs to the maintainer named below.

named custodian: Zorok Briir Novvan